How to Choose the Right Dummy Camera for Your Needs
When selecting a fake security camera, or dummy camera, the first step is to understand your specific needs. Are you looking to deter potential thieves? Or perhaps you need a realistic-looking camera for a film set? The right choice depends on the level of detail and functionality required. For instance, high-quality models with LED indicators and moving parts can be highly effective in securing areas against theft, mimicking the presence of an actual surveillance system.
For simple deterrence, opt for cameras that blend seamlessly into their surroundings. Realistic design, complete with simulated wiring, can go a long way in convincing would-be intruders. Consider your environment – indoor or outdoor – and choose cameras designed accordingly. Features like weatherproofing ensure outdoor durability while discreet installation options keep them hidden from prying eyes. Remember, the goal is to create the illusion of a fully functional security system without the actual cost and hassle of real cameras.
Installation Tips for Securing Your Dummy Cameras Against Theft
When installing fake security cameras with simulated wiring, securing them against theft is a priority. Mounting the cameras in visible areas and strategically placing them near lights or other deterrents can significantly reduce the risk of vandalism or theft. Additionally, consider using sturdy mounts that cannot be easily disassembled. Concealing the power cables with realistic-looking mock wiring adds to the deception, making it harder for potential thieves to identify and disrupt the camera’s functionality.
To further enhance security, integrate motion sensors or alarm systems that trigger when unauthorized access is detected. Regularly test these features to ensure they function optimally. Also, keep a close eye on the cameras’ remote access points and ensure any connections are secure. By implementing these tips, you can make your dummy cameras more effective in deterring theft and maintaining a sense of security.
